Brown Midrib Forage Sorghum, Sudangrass, and Corn: What Is the Potential?

Brown midrib, a genetic mutation in several grassy species, reduces lignin content in the total plant parts. Lignin is mostly indigestible but also plays an important role in plant rigidity. During the past several years the brown midrib (bmr) trait has been incorporated into forage sorghum, sudangrass, and corn. The results have been significant for the most part. Optimum Stand Height for Forage Brown Midrib Sorghum · Sudangrass in North-eastern USA

Brown midrib sorghum · sudangrass is attracting attention in the north-eastern USA because of its ability to produce acceptable forage yields on marginal corn ground.
